Remote Senior Machine Learning Engineer

closed
Logo of Everbridge

Everbridge

πŸ’΅ $138k-$185k
πŸ“Remote - Canada

Job highlights

Summary

Join our team of ML, Software and Data engineers as a Senior Machine Learning Engineer to develop, deploy and optimize NLP and other AI/ML models powering Everbridge's risk intelligence automation tools and CEM analytics, planning, and forecasting products.

Requirements

  • Master's degree in a technical field (or equivalent work experience)
  • 5+ years of experience developing and deploying NLP models (e.g. BERT, BART, DistilBERT) in production
  • 5+ years of experience programming with Python in a production setting
  • 3+ years of hands-on experience with machine learning frameworks (e.g. PyTorch, TensorFlow)
  • Strong experience in deploying machine learning models using cloud platforms (e.g., AWS SageMaker, Azure ML)
  • Strong computer science, machine learning, and MLOps fundamentals
  • Experience with distributed data processing frameworks (e.g. Spark, Storm) and working with data platforms like Snowflake
  • Experience with Docker, Kubernetes, and Airflow for managing deployments and pipelines
  • Familiarity with GPU computing (i.e., CUDA and cuDNN)

Responsibilities

  • Develop, deploy, and optimize NLP and other AI/ML models powering Everbridge’s risk intelligence automation tools and CEM analytics, planning, and forecasting products
  • Partner with a group of ML, software, and data engineers to define data models, acquire data sets, and build data pipelines necessary to power real-time data and analytics product capabilities
  • Collaborate with software and data engineers to design and implement scalable machine learning platforms and workflows for seamless deployment and monitoring
  • Ensure models are robustly deployed using cloud-based platforms such as AWS SageMaker, and integrate with tools like Snowflake for data management and processing
  • Mentor junior team members and establish machine learning engineering best practices, including a strong focus on MLOps principles (continuous integration, continuous delivery, monitoring)

Benefits

  • Healthcare
  • Dental care
  • Mental health benefits
  • Disability income benefits
  • Life and AD&D insurance
  • Retirement savings plan with employer match
  • Paid time off
This job is filled or no longer available